Hesse: Fastnacht symbol "Urnarr" set up again in "Klaa Paris".

Frankfurt / Main (dpa / lhe) - In the Frankfurt district of Heddernheim - a foolish stronghold in the Main metropolis - the restored statue of the great fool was handed over on Friday. The carnival symbol had been dismantled, repaired and cleaned a few weeks ago, as announced by the Frankfurt Transport Company (VGF). "It is the origin of the carnival. It was set up back then as a reminder of the original carnival," said Ulrich Fergenbauer, chairman of the "Klaa Paris" train community, on Friday about the original fool figure erected in 1989. "We are pleased that the local advisory board and the VGF have put this together," said Fergenbauer. Heddernheim is affectionately called "Klaa Paris" in Frankfurt

The statue had previously been posted above the carnival fountain at the Heddernheim underground station. The fountain was demolished after repeated vandalism. According to Fergenbauer, a water leak from the well was another reason for the demolition. In the future, the original fool will stand on a five-ton sandstone base that was delivered using a crane truck. A traditional carnival parade was planned for Friday evening, starting from the statue. The local advisory board bore the cost of repairing the figure, and VGF financed the demolition of the fountain.
